About

Shaorui Wang is a scholar working on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is, Pollution and Civil and Structural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Shaorui Wang has authored 69 papers receiving a total of 1.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 34 papers in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is, 23 papers in Pollution and 11 papers in Civil and Structural Engineering. Recurrent topics in Shaorui Wang’s work include Toxic Organic Pollutants Impact (31 papers), Structural Engineering and Vibration Analysis (9 papers) and Microplastics and Plastic Pollution (8 papers). Shaorui Wang is often cited by papers focused on Toxic Organic Pollutants Impact (31 papers), Structural Engineering and Vibration Analysis (9 papers) and Microplastics and Plastic Pollution (8 papers). Shaorui Wang coll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and United Kingdom. Shaorui Wang's co-authors include Gan Zhang, Chunling Luo, Marta Venier, Yan Wang, Amina Salamova, Kevin Romanak, Jun Li, Michael Hendryx, William A. Stubbings and Huashou Li and has published in prestigious journals such as Environmental Science & Technology, The Science of The Total Environment and Journal of Hazardous Materials.
